158: Chapter 157 The Fourth True Meaning: Heavenly Fire!

Jiang Hanzhou fell silent.

This was a question he had never considered before.

He had never imagined that having too many True Intents could actually become an obstacle to a Breakthrough.

"Of course, you don't need to worry too much," Master Xue Mu's tone softened. "Having many True Intents makes a Breakthrough difficult, but once you do break through, you will be an invincible existence within the same Realm."

"I was the same back in my day. It took me a full thirty years to condense six types of True Intent and advance from the Primal Elephant Realm to the Dragon Fetus. It took another thirty years from the Dragon Fetus to the Jiaotai Realm. From the Jiaotai Realm to the Mysterious Glimpse Realm, I have yet to make a Breakthrough even now."

When he said this, his tone was calm, without a trace of frustration.

"But I have no regrets," he said. "Because I know that once I step into the Mysterious Glimpse Realm, I will be the strongest existence within that Realm."

Jiang Hanzhou raised his head to look at this old man with red hair and a red beard.

In those red eyes, there was no confusion, no unwillingness, only determination and self-confidence.

"This Disciple understands," he said.

Master Xue Mu nodded and smiled with satisfaction.

"Alright, we can discuss these deeper truths slowly in the future. Now, I have two tasks to arrange for you."

He stood up, walked to the window, and pointed to a cliff in the distance.

That cliff was located on the west side of Red Fire Peak, about a hundred zhang high. It was grayish-white throughout, appearing particularly abrupt amidst the crimson mountain body.

The cliff was crisscrossed with countless sword marks.

Some were several feet deep, some as shallow as a strand of hair; some were fierce and overbearing, some continuous and unending, some sharp and piercing, and some heavy and steady...

Every sword mark contained some kind of profound Concept.

"That is Lijian Cliff," Master Xue Mu said. "It holds the sword marks left by the generations of sword experts of Dragon Abyss Palace. From the Ancestral Master who founded the sect to the Grand Elder still alive today, all have left their marks upon it."

"You will go to the foot of the cliff every day to meditate, using your Golden Sharpness True Intent to sense the Metal element Concept within those sword marks. When you can leave your own sword mark on that cliff wall, your Golden Sharpness True Intent will be considered a Minor Achievement."

Jiang Hanzhou gazed at the cliff covered in sword marks, his eyes flickering with a burning light.

"This Disciple will remember."

"The second task," Master Xue Mu continued, "Red Fire Peak has a Forbidden Ground called the 'Earth Fire Cave'."

"That is the core of the earth fire spiritual vein, where the Fire element Spiritual Qi is concentrated to the extreme. An ordinary Cultivator who enters will be burned to ashes before they can last a single incense stick's time."

"But if you can endure it, the Earth Fire power there is the supreme treasure for Body Tempering."

He turned to look at Jiang Hanzhou.

"What level have you Cultivated your Li Huo Golden Body Art to?"

"The fourth level, Condensing Qi into Flame," Jiang Hanzhou said.

A hint of approval flashed in Master Xue Mu's eyes.

"The fourth level, not bad. If you can enter the Earth Fire Cave and use the power of the earth fire to temper your Physical Body, you might be able to achieve a Breakthrough to the fifth level—Blood Burning."

"Blood Burning?" Jiang Hanzhou raised an eyebrow.

"Yes," Master Xue Mu nodded. "The fifth level of the Li Huo Golden Body Art is called 'Blood Burning'. It uses the Lihuo True Flame to ignite one's own Qi and blood, transforming amidst the burning and being reborn amidst the destruction. Once you break through, your Qi and blood power will surge several times over, and your recovery ability will be astonishing."

He paused, a profound look flashing in his eyes.

"Furthermore, if you can Cultivate in the Earth Fire Cave, you might be able to capture the fourth kind of True Intent—Heavenly Fire."

Heavenly Fire.

Jiang Hanzhou's heart skipped a beat.

Master Xue Mu looked at him and smiled slightly.

"What? Are you tempted?"

Jiang Hanzhou took a deep breath and nodded slowly.

"This Disciple is willing to try."

Master Xue Mu laughed heartily and patted his shoulder.

"Good! This is what a Disciple of mine, Master Xue Mu, should be!"

He walked back to his seat, picked up his teacup, and drained it in one gulp.

"Starting tomorrow, you will go to Lijian Cliff to meditate on the sword marks for three hours every day. In the afternoon, enter the Earth Fire Cave for Body Tempering; hold on for as long as you can."

"I will prepare the Medicinal Pill, Spirit Stone, and the access token for the Earth Fire Cave for you."

"Half a year later, the Dragon Gate Trial will begin—if you feel you are prepared, go and give it a try."

Jiang Hanzhou stood up and bowed solemnly.

"This Disciple will surely give it my all."

Master Xue Mu waved his hand, signaling him to sit down.

"Alright, that is all for today. Go back and rest; tomorrow morning, a young attendant will take you to Lijian Cliff."

Jiang Hanzhou nodded, stood up, and took his leave.

Walking out of Lihuo Hall, the setting sun was slowly sinking into the West Sea.

The entire Red Fire Peak was bathed in golden-red afterglow. In front of the scattered Immortal Caves, Disciples were coming in and out; some were holding Medicinal Pills, some carrying spiritual materials, and some were in groups of three or five, whispering to one another.

Jiang Hanzhou stood on the platform in front of the hall, watching this scene, and a feeling that was hard to describe suddenly welled up in his heart.

This was Dragon Abyss Palace.

This was Red Fire Peak.

This was the place where he would Cultivate from now on.

He took a deep breath, drawing the aura of the crimson mountain deep into his lungs, then turned and walked towards his own Immortal Cave.

The Immortal Cave was located on the mountainside. It was a naturally formed stone grotto that had been simply excavated and renovated to become a place suitable for living and Cultivation.

In front of the entrance was a Formation light curtain, which could be opened using the token Master Xue Mu had given him.

He stepped into the Immortal Cave.

The interior was not large, about three zhang square, with a stone bed, a stone table, a stone stool, and a small Cultivation room, with a simple Spirit Gathering Formation engraved on the floor.

Simple.

But it was enough.

Jiang Hanzhou sat cross-legged on the stone bed and closed his eyes.

Deep within his Sea of Consciousness, that golden light remained brilliant, intertwining with the deep blue of the Tide and the red-gold of the Pure Yang to form a magnificent three-colored canopy.

Golden Sharpness True Intent, one layer achieved.

Half a year.

He opened his eyes and looked at the sky outside the window, which was gradually darkening.

Half a year later, the Dragon Gate Trial.

He wanted to see it.

He wanted to know just how strong those true Prodigies were.

He also wanted to know just what height his "Late Bloomer" fate could take him to.

The night grew deeper, and the lights on Red Fire Peak lit up one after another, like stars dotting every corner of this fiery red mountain.

Jiang Hanzhou withdrew his gaze and closed his eyes.

Inside his body, the Lihuo True Flame burned quietly, nourishing every inch of his Meridians and every wisp of his Qi and blood.
